Also, be sure of the correct terminology. Know what network service names, connection strings, etc. are. I went into the exam last week knowing exactly what these things LOOKED like in the config files but not what you're meant to call them (although it was possible to work them out from clearly wrong other choices...; being the only guy setting up these files here I've never had to call them anything in real life!) Have a look at the Oracle 8 Cram Session sheet although it doesn't go into enough detail for the exam - the Oracle manual seems to cover things pretty closely to the format of the exam (much more than for the other exams I reckon).
